Specifications

Dimensions + Mounting Patterns

FRX-Pro-Mōvi -Carbon-Freefly-Store-FIG- \(7\)

Item                                   Dimensions

  • Length                            15.6mm

  • Height                          67.0mm

  • Width                           42.4mm
    Mounting Pattern M3 – 15mm x 15mm Grid

  • Weight                          62.2g
    Voltage                           5 V

  • Signal Power                10mW – 1W (User adjustable)

  • Frequency                     902 – 928MHz *

  • Spread Method            Frequency Hopping

  • Range 1700m               [5600ft] (Based on testing) **

  • Antenna Connector    RP-SMA
    Operational Temperature Range -20 to 50C

*FRX Pro’s alternative frequencies to be released in the near future
**Range is dependent on Signal power settings, RF environment, and line of sight

Using FRX Pro

Mounting

FRX Pro Mounting

FRX-Pro-Mōvi -Carbon-Freefly-Store-FIG- \(8\)

  • Install a FRX Pro module to your gimbal using the Pop-n-Lock dovetail and a Pop-n- Lock mounted to the pan axis of your gimbal. See the diagram below for suggested mounting areas on your gimbal.
    • If necessary you can update the orientation of the Pop-n-Lock dovetail to make adjust the orientation of the FRX Pro module.
    • Alternatively, you can utilize the zip-tie featuresFRX-Pro-Mōvi -Carbon-Freefly-Store-FIG- \(9\)
  • Mount the other FRX Pro module to your MōVI Controller setup.
    • We suggest using a Screw Mount Pop-n-Lock kit to utilize one of the many 1/4- 20″ mounting location on the MōVI Controller and most monitors.FRX-Pro-Mōvi -Carbon-Freefly-Store-FIG- \(10\)

FRX Pro Wiring
Gimbal Side

  • Unplug any devices from COM1 of the gimbal’s GCU.
    • When using FRX Pro you will no longer need the older MC-RX’s. These can be removed from the gimbal.
  • Use one of the COM Cables provided in the kit to connect the FRX Pro’s UART port to the COM1 port of your gimbal.FRX-Pro-Mōvi -Carbon-Freefly-Store-FIG- \(11\)

Controller Side

  • Connect the other FRX Pro module to the MōVI Controller using the USB Cable provided in the kit.
    • Ensure you have plugged the USB Cable into the bottom USB port on the MōVI Controller.FRX-Pro-Mōvi -Carbon-Freefly-Store-FIG- \(12\)

Binding and Setup

FRX Pro Binding

FRX-Pro-Mōvi -Carbon-Freefly-Store-FIG- \(13\)

  • Turn on the gimbal and MōVI Controller that the FRX Pro’s are going to link.
    • The FRX Pro’s status light will turn white during boot and standby.
    • If the FRX Pro modules are already bound and connected to a gimbal and controller which are running, the status lights will turn green after a few seconds.
  • If the status light remains white, press the bind button of the FRX Pro connected to the controller, wait one second, then press the bind button of the other FRX Pro.
    • Both FRX Pro’s status lights will begin flashing white and the modules will initiate the binding procedure.
  • Once a data connection is established both the status lights on the FRX Pro modules will turn green.
  • ‘If the FRX Pro modules cannot establish a connection the status lights will turn red and then return to their standby state.
    • Repeat the binding steps above if a binding attempt fails.

MoVI Controller Setup

  • To use the MōVI Controller with FRX Pro you must change the MōVi Controller’s Radio
    Type setting to ‘USB’

    • To access this setting navigate to the MōVI Controller’s Radio Config menu and use the Menu Set knob to change the Radio Type to ‘USB’
  • Once the setting has been changed, ‘Write’ it to the MōVI Controller’s memory by selecting the ‘Write’ field on the next line and pressing the Menu Set knob.

    • To use the old MC-RX with this MōVI Controller, you must set the Radio Type back to ‘Internal’

In order to use FRX Pro with your MōVI Controller you must be using a MōVI Controller that has been updated to v4.1.X or newer. This FW will be available once the first FRX Pros are shipped!

Running dual MōVI Controllers using FRX Pro is not possible, due to the FRX Pro’s large power draw it consumes the power from both COM ports on the GCU. Please use the MōVI Controller Receivers when attempting to use two MōVI Controllers.

Updating FRX Pro

FRX Pro’s ship with the latest stable FW preloaded onto each module so no updating is necessary before use!

  • To update the FRX Pro module you will need to download the latest FRX Pro FW to a PC.
    • You can find the latest FW packages on the FRX Pro’s support page.
    • For the latest MōVI Controller FW, please visit the MōVI Controller Support page.
  • Connect the USB A-C cable to your computer then plug in the FRX Pro module while holding down its Bind button.
    • The status light will turn blue indicating it is in FW Update Mode.
  • Open the configurator bundled with the FRX Pro FW and connect to the correct COM port using the drop down menu at the top of the configurator.
    • When connected the rest of the configurator will become editable and the box at the top right of the configurator will turn green.
  • With the correct COM port selected, choose the new firmware file using the Browse button.
    • The name of the file will be FRX_Pro_x-x-x_xxxxxxxx.enc.
  • Click the Load button to begin the FW load process. After a few seconds, the new firmware file will be sent to the FRX Pro module. Wait for the progress to reach 100%.
    • If FW load fails make sure you are in the FW Update Mode.
  • FRX Pro modules are updated individually; this means each module must be updated when an FW update is released.

Configuring FRX Pro

FRX Pro’s power and baud rate can be adjusted when necessary, for instruction review the steps detailed out below.

  • To enter Configuration mode simply connect an FRX to a PC using a USB A-C cable.
    • Do not press the bind button to enter the Configuration mode.
  • Open the configurator bundled with the FRX Pro FW and connect to the correct COM port using the drop-down menu at the top of the configurator.
  • With the COM port selected, press the Start Configuration Mode button.
  • The Power Level and Aux Baud Rate can now be adjusted and written to the FRX Pro module using the Write Configuration button.
    • ]Always use an Aux baud Rate of ‘111111’ when using FRX Pro with the MōVI family of gimbals.
    • To reset the FRX Pro module to defaults select the Default Configuration button in the configurator.
